tracer

Pronunciation: /ˈtɹeɪsɚ/

Estimated CEFR level: C2 — Proficiency

Estimated from word frequency; not an official CEFR classification.

Definition

  1. noun an investigator who is employed to find missing persons or missing goods
  2. noun an instrument used to make tracings
  3. noun (radiology) any radioactive isotope introduced into the body to study metabolism or other biological processes

Etymology

From trace + -er.
